Understanding Car Key Remotes
Car key remotes, often referred to as key fobs, utilize radio frequency technology to interact with a vehicle's locking mechanism. They usually serve numerous functions, such as:
Locking/Unlocking the doors: This is the main function of many key fobs.Beginning the engine: Some advanced models permit keyless entry and keyless ignition.Activating the panic mode: A function that can assist in emergencies by sounding the alarm and flashing the lights.Tailgate release: Many remotes can likewise open the trunk or tailgate.
The complexity of a remote control will identify the procedure and expense of replacement.
Types of Car Key Remotes
Requirement Key Fobs: These typically feature a few buttons (lock, unlock, trunk) and do not have advanced features. Replacement expenses are typically lower.
Smart Keys: Typically related to luxury and contemporary lorries, clever keys enable keyless entry and beginning, usually needing more sophisticated programs.
Transponder Keys: These keys consist of a chip that interacts with the vehicle's ignition system. If the chip is not acknowledged, the vehicle will not start. Replacement often requires reprogramming.
Flip Keys: These consist of the basic key and a remote fob integrated. They fold into the key body for benefit and need correct shows for replacement.

Replacing a car key remote can appear challenging, but it can generally be accomplished by following these uncomplicated actions:
Identify Your Vehicle's Key Type: Consult your vehicle's handbook or call a dealer to determine the right type of key remote needed for your model.
Examine for Warranty: If your key remote is still under service warranty, consult the dealer about replacement choices at no charge.
Buy a Replacement: Look for a replacement remote through authorized dealers or relied on locksmiths. Online choices are also readily available, but ensure compatibility with your vehicle.
Programming the Key: Depending on the kind of key you purchase, it might require shows to integrate with your vehicle. This could include:
DIY programming (for some basic fobs)Visiting a professional locksmith professionalGoing to a dealership
Testing the Remote: Once set, test every function of the key remote to guarantee it works properly.
